Valerie Parker

For as long as I can remember I’ve had an interest in painting, a compulsion to explore the beautiful works that the artist of our world have given us as a legacy, and ultimately a source of great pleasure.

Like many, I’ve treasured my visits to art galleries and exhibitions all over the world. Having lived in Europe for 21 years I’ve been fortunate to take art classes with very talented artists who have contributed immeasurable to my fascination with, and love of painting.

Collecting and creating art for some 30 years now, I often reflect on what it means to me, and what the first indication, or spark on interest, in art in all its forms that I recall.
I believe it was ‘colour’. I was always attracted to the intensity, drama, and joy that colour gave me.

This interest leads me to always seek out art courses to explore my passion.
Most memorable were my 12 years in Brussels, living in a Flemish Community, everyone paints! I was delighted to be accepted into a class taught by Angele Hoovelt, albeit the classes were in Flemish..Angele offered me the use of her studio to paint at any time, then she would individually critique my work, this was an amazing opportunity.
My paintings lean towards the classic realist style, and cover many genre.

Returning to Melbourne in 2003, I continued classes with various groups. Being fortunate to exhibit my work in many exhibitions and Co-organising an Exhibition of Peruvian Art at the BMW Edge Fed Square. A painting trip to Peru being the impetus there.
A delightful Exhibition in Kew Ín an Artists Garden’.  An exhibition of my work of The Great Ocean Road ‘Viewpoints’ in Torquay 2018.  This was a highlight of a number of years painting the area.

The painting process gives a multitude of rewards. The challenge, diligence required,  thoughtful details. Painting can teach you a lot about yourself.
‘My Journey in Art continues’. It’s a beautiful journey, one that I am always grateful that I’ve been able to take.
